/*@charset "utf-8";*/
/*��������css ��˼��*/
#b_jdjxc .b_clear { clear:both; }
#b_jdjxc ul { list-style:none; }
#b_jdjxc {width:1420px;margin:0 auto;}
#b_onimg{width:1420px; height:520px; position:relative; margin-top:-520px; text-align:center;}
#b_onimg img{ width: 100%;}
#b_imgrolling { clear:both; }
#b_imgrolling .b_imagebg { height:520px; overflow:hidden; position:relative; }
#b_imgrolling .b_imagebg li { height:520px; overflow:hidden; width:1420px; margin:0 auto; display:block; text-align:center; }
#b_imgrolling .b_imagebg li img {width:100.3%;}
#b_imgrolling .b_b_scrollbg { height:240px; background:url(../images/b_scroll_bg.png) no-repeat center center; z-index: 9; position: relative;background-size: auto 100%;}
#b_imgrolling .b_scroll {width:1090px;height:282px;position:relative;margin:0 auto;}
#b_imgrolling .b_pre, .b_next {display:block;position:absolute;width:48px;height:76px;}
#b_imgrolling a.b_pre {background:url(../images/arr_l.png);top:90px;left:0;}
#b_imgrolling a.b_pre:hover {background:url(../images/arr_l_on.png);}
#b_imgrolling a.b_next {background:url(../images/arr_r.png);top:90px;right:0;}
#b_imgrolling a.b_next:hover {background:url(../images/arr_r_on.png);}
#b_imgrolling .b_outscroll_pic {width:952px;height:282px;overflow:hidden;margin-left:70px;position:relative;top:2px;}
#b_imgrolling .b_outscroll_pic .b_scroll_img {position:absolute}
#b_imgrolling .b_scroll_img {margin:0 auto;width:40000px;height:282px;}
#b_imgrolling .b_scroll_img li {float:left;height:95px;width:171px;margin:60px 9px;_margin:5px 14px 5px 4px;cursor:pointer;overflow: hidden;}
#b_imgrolling .b_scroll_img li img{ max-height:100%;}
#b_imgrolling .b_scroll .b_present {width:170px;height:95px;border:2px #fff solid;background:url(../images/arr_on.png) 50% -4px no-repeat;z-index:10;position:absolute;top:60px;left:0;}
.b_imagebgli_v{
    position: absolute;
    z-index: 8;
    left: 50%;
    bottom: 100px;
    margin-left: -600px;
    width: 820px;
    height: 408px; /*overflow: hidden;*/
}
.b_imagebgli_v video{ position: absolute; left: 0px; bottom: 0px; width: 100%; max-height: 100%;border-radius: 10px 0px 0px 10px; 
    border: 1px solid; border-right:0px solid; border-left:3px solid; border-top:0px solid; border-bottom:0px solid;
    border-image: -webkit-linear-gradient( rgba(255,255,255,0), rgba(255,255,255,1),rgba(255,255,255,0)) 1 1;
    border-image: -moz-linear-gradient( rgba(255,255,255,0), rgba(255,255,255,1),rgba(255,255,255,0)) 1 1;
    border-image: linear-gradient( rgba(255,255,255,0), rgba(255,255,255,1),rgba(255,255,255,0)) 1 1;
    -webkit-box-shadow:0 0 10px #000;  
    -moz-box-shadow:0 0 10px #000;  
    box-shadow:0 0 10px #000;  
}
#b_onimgx{ width: 100%; height: 80px; margin-bottom: -80px; }

.b_m_fmenu {
    position: absolute;
    margin-left: 222.2px;
    left: 50%;
    bottom: 100px;font-size: 23px;
    width: 280px; height: 410px;
    z-index: 100;
    border: 1px solid; border-right:3px solid; border-left:0px solid; border-top:0px solid; border-bottom:0px solid;
    border-radius: 0px 10px 10px 0px;
    border-image: -webkit-linear-gradient( rgba(255,255,255,0), rgba(255,255,255,1),rgba(255,255,255,0)) 1 1;
    border-image: -moz-linear-gradient( rgba(255,255,255,0), rgba(255,255,255,1),rgba(255,255,255,0)) 1 1;
    border-image: linear-gradient( rgba(255,255,255,0), rgba(255,255,255,1),rgba(255,255,255,0)) 1 1;
    border-top: 0px;
    background: -webkit-linear-gradient(rgba(0,160,233,0), rgba(0,160,233,1),rgba(0,160,233,0));
    background: -o-linear-gradient(rgba(0,160,233,0), rgba(0,160,233,1),rgba(0,160,233,0));
    background: -moz-linear-gradient(rgba(0,160,233,0), rgba(0,160,233,1),rgba(0,160,233,0));
    background: linear-gradient(rgba(0,160,233,0), rgba(0,160,233,1),rgba(0,160,233,0));
}
.b_m_fmenu a{ color: #ffffff; }
.b_m_fmenu .b_m_tabNav .b_m_now{ height: 51px; line-height: 51px; color: #ffffff; border-bottom: 1px solid rgba(255, 255, 255, 0.3);    text-shadow: 1px 1px 1px #aaaaaa;}
.b_m_fmenu .b_m_tabNav .b_m_now a{ float: left; height: 51px; color: #ffffff; line-height: 51px;}
.b_m_fmenu .b_m_tabNav .b_m_now span{ padding: 0px 0px 0px 15px; margin-right: 15px; height: 51px; line-height: 51px; }
.b_m_nowon {
    background-color: rgba(0, 192, 192, 0.7); font-weight: bold;
}

@media screen and (min-width:1420px) { /* ִ��1200px���css*/
}
@media screen and (min-width: 1220px) and (max-width: 1419px) { /*ִ��1000px���css*/
#b_jdjxc .b_clear { clear:both; }
#b_jdjxc ul { list-style:none; }
#b_jdjxc {width:1220px;margin:0 auto;}
#b_onimg{width:1220px; height:446px; position:relative; margin-top:-446px; text-align:center;}
#b_onimg img{max-width: 100%;}
#b_imgrolling { clear:both; }
#b_imgrolling .b_imagebg { height:446px; overflow:hidden; position:relative; }
#b_imgrolling .b_imagebg li { height:446px; overflow:hidden; width:1220px; margin:0 auto; display:block; text-align:center; }
#b_imgrolling .b_imagebg li img {width:100.3%;}
#b_imgrolling .b_b_scrollbg { height:282px; background:url(../images/b_scroll_bg.png) no-repeat center center; }
#b_imgrolling .b_scroll {width:1090px;height:282px;position:relative;margin:0 auto;}
#b_imgrolling .b_pre, .b_next {display:block;position:absolute;width:48px;height:76px;}
#b_imgrolling a.b_pre {background:url(../images/arr_l.png);top:90px;left:0;}
#b_imgrolling a.b_pre:hover {background:url(../images/arr_l_on.png);}
#b_imgrolling a.b_next {background:url(../images/arr_r.png);top:90px;right:0;}
#b_imgrolling a.b_next:hover {background:url(../images/arr_r_on.png);}
#b_imgrolling .b_outscroll_pic {width:952px;height:282px;overflow:hidden;margin-left:70px;position:relative;top:2px;}
#b_imgrolling .b_outscroll_pic .b_scroll_img {position:absolute}
#b_imgrolling .b_scroll_img {margin:0 auto;width:40000px;height:282px;}
#b_imgrolling .b_scroll_img li {float:left;height:95px;width:171px;margin:60px 9px;_margin:5px 14px 5px 4px;cursor:pointer;overflow: hidden;}
#b_imgrolling .b_scroll_img li img{ max-height:100%;}
#b_imgrolling .b_scroll .b_present {width:170px;height:95px;border:2px #fff solid;background:url(../images/arr_on.png) 50% -4px no-repeat;z-index:10;position:absolute;top:60px;left:0;}
}
@media screen and (min-width: 750px) and (max-width: 1219px) { /*ִ��750px���css*/
#b_jdjxc .b_clear { clear:both; }
#b_jdjxc ul { list-style:none; }
#b_jdjxc {width:750px;margin:0 auto;}
#b_onimg{width:750px; height:273px; position:relative; margin-top:-273px; text-align:center;}
#b_onimg img{max-width: 100%;}
#b_imgrolling { clear:both; }
#b_imgrolling .b_imagebg { height:273px; overflow:hidden; position:relative; }
#b_imgrolling .b_imagebg li { height:273px; overflow:hidden; width:750px; margin:0 auto; display:block; text-align:center; }
#b_imgrolling .b_imagebg li img {width:100.3%;}
#b_imgrolling .b_b_scrollbg { height:0px; background:url(../images/b_scroll_bg.png) no-repeat center center; }
#b_imgrolling .b_scroll {width:750px;height:282px;position:relative;margin:0 auto;}
#b_imgrolling .b_pre, .b_next {display:block;position:absolute;width:48px;height:76px;}
#b_imgrolling a.b_pre {background:url(../images/arr_l.png);top:-173px;left:0;}
#b_imgrolling a.b_pre:hover {background:url(../images/arr_l_on.png);}
#b_imgrolling a.b_next {background:url(../images/arr_r.png);top:-173px;right:0;}
#b_imgrolling a.b_next:hover {background:url(../images/arr_r_on.png);}
#b_imgrolling .b_outscroll_pic {width:598px;height:282px;overflow:hidden;margin-left:70px;position:relative;top:2px;}
#b_imgrolling .b_outscroll_pic .b_scroll_img {position:absolute}
#b_imgrolling .b_scroll_img {margin:0 auto;width:40000px;height:282px;}
#b_imgrolling .b_scroll_img li {float:left;height:95px;width:171px;margin:60px 9px;_margin:5px 14px 5px 4px;cursor:pointer;overflow: hidden;}
#b_imgrolling .b_scroll_img li img{ max-height:100%;}
#b_imgrolling .b_scroll .b_present {width:170px;height:95px;border:2px #fff solid;background:url(../images/arr_on.png) 50% -4px no-repeat;z-index:10;position:absolute;top:60px;left:0;}
}
@media screen and (max-width: 749px) { /*ִ��100%���Ȱ��css*/
#b_jdjxc .b_clear { clear:both; }
#b_jdjxc ul { list-style:none; }
#b_jdjxc {width:320px;margin:0 auto;}
#b_onimg{width:320px; height:116px; position:relative; margin-top:-116px; text-align:center;}
#b_onimg img{max-width: 100%;}
#b_imgrolling { clear:both; }
#b_imgrolling .b_imagebg { height:116px; overflow:hidden; position:relative; }
#b_imgrolling .b_imagebg li { height:116px; overflow:hidden; width:320px; margin:0 auto; display:block; text-align:center; }
#b_imgrolling .b_imagebg li img {width:100.3%;}
#b_imgrolling .b_b_scrollbg { height:0px; background:url(../images/b_scroll_bg.png) no-repeat center center; }
#b_imgrolling .b_scroll {width:320px;height:282px;position:relative;margin:0 auto;}
#b_imgrolling .b_pre, .b_next {display:block;position:absolute;width:48px;height:76px;}
#b_imgrolling a.b_pre {background:url(../images/arr_l.png);top:-96px;left:0;}
#b_imgrolling a.b_pre:hover {background:url(../images/arr_l_on.png);}
#b_imgrolling a.b_next {background:url(../images/arr_r.png);top:-96px;right:0;}
#b_imgrolling a.b_next:hover {background:url(../images/arr_r_on.png);}
#b_imgrolling .b_outscroll_pic {width:598px;height:282px;overflow:hidden;margin-left:70px;position:relative;top:2px;}
#b_imgrolling .b_outscroll_pic .b_scroll_img {position:absolute}
#b_imgrolling .b_scroll_img {margin:0 auto;width:40000px;height:282px;}
#b_imgrolling .b_scroll_img li {float:left;height:95px;width:171px;margin:60px 9px;_margin:5px 14px 5px 4px;cursor:pointer;overflow: hidden;}
#b_imgrolling .b_scroll_img li img{ max-height:100%;}
#b_imgrolling .b_scroll .b_present {width:170px;height:95px;border:2px #fff solid;background:url(../images/arr_on.png) 50% -4px no-repeat;z-index:10;position:absolute;top:60px;left:0;}
}
